.promo21,.promo21 p,.promo21 li{font-size:18px;line-height:24px}.promo21-header{min-height:580px;background-size:cover;background-position:center center;background-repeat:no-repeat;background-attachment:scroll;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.promo21-header .inner{padding:60px 0;position:relative}.promo21-header-title h1{font-family:'proxima_nova_ltlight',sans-serif;font-size:36px;padding-top:50px;line-height:43.85px;text-align:center;font-weight:400;max-width:470px;margin:auto}.promo21-header-tiles{display:-webkit-box;display:-ms-flexbox;display:flex;margin-top:40px;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.promo21-customer h2{font-size:36px;line-height:44px}.promo21-customer .promo21-header-tiles{-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line;margin-top:100px}.promo21-customer .promo21-header-cust-tile{max-width:290px;color:#fff;font-size:18px;line-height:22px;text-align:center}.promo21-customer .promo21-header-cust-tile strong{display:block;margin-bottom:1.3em}.promo21-customer .promo21-header-title h1{padding-top:0}.promo21-customer .promo21-header{background-image:url('/static/images/info/fan/promo21_header/Navstevnik_01_WEB_foto-Radek Herold-Beseda u Bigbítu-Black.jpg')}@media only screen and (-webkit-min-device-pixel-ratio:2),only screen and (min-device-pixel-ratio:2),only screen and (min-resolution:192dpi){.promo21-customer .promo21-header{background-image:url('/static/images/info/fan/promo21_header/Navstevnik_01_WEB_foto-Radek Herold-Beseda u Bigbítu-Black.jpg')}}.promo21-header-cust-number{margin-bottom:36px;line-height:40px;font-size:34px;text-align:center}.promo21-contacts{background:#fff;padding:56px 0 120px}.promo21-contacts .intro{margin-bottom:60px}.promo21-faqs{padding:50px 0 120px;background:#f3f3f3}.map-shops-wrapper a,.map-shops-wrapper a:focus{color:#009deb;text-decoration:none}.map-shops-wrapper a:hover{text-decoration:underline}#map{width:100%;height:630px;margin-top:20px;background-color:#f3f3f3}#info-shop{margin-top:40px}.shop{clear:both;border-bottom:1px solid #ebebeb;padding-top:10px;padding-bottom:10px}.shop:first-of-type{border-top:1px solid #ebebeb}.shop .row{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;padding-top:25px;padding-bottom:15px}.shop-group+.shop-group{margin-top:60px}.shop-group h2{margin-bottom:20px}.shop .row .col{position:relative;box-sizing:border-box;float:left;width:25%;padding-left:10px;border-left:1px solid silver}.shop .row .col .social{position:absolute;bottom:0;left:10px;-webkit-transition:all .25s;-o-transition:all .25s;transition:all .25s;-webkit-transform:translate(0,100px);-ms-transform:translate(0,100px);transform:translate(0,100px)}.shop.open .row .col .social{-webkit-transform:translate(0,0);-ms-transform:translate(0,0);transform:translate(0,0)}.shop .row .col .social a{float:left;display:block;width:28px;height:28px;overflow:hidden;text-indent:-999px;background-size:contain;background-repeat:no-repeat;background-position:center}.shop .row .col .social a.web{background-image:url('/static/images/info/fan/WEB-ICON.svg')}.shop .row .col .social a.fb{background-image:url('/static/images/info/fan/FB-ICON.svg')}.shop .row .col .social a+a{margin-left:10px}.js .shop-title{position:relative;padding-right:30px;cursor:pointer}.js .shop-title:after{display:block;content:'';position:absolute;top:0;right:0;width:15px;height:1.2em;line-height:24px;font-family:"entypo";-webkit-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.js .shop.open .shop-title:after{-web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}.js .shop .row{height:auto;max-height:0;padding-top:0;padding-bottom:0;overflow:hidden;transition:all .2s ease-in-out}.js .shop.open .row{max-height:250px;padding-top:25px;padding-bottom:15px}.promo21-faqs .inner{margin-top:30px;border-top:1px solid #b3b3b3}.promo21-faq-title{font-family:'proxima_nova_rgbold',sans-serif}.promo21-faq{border-bottom:1px solid #b3b3b3;padding:25px 0}.promo21-faq a{color:inherit}.js .promo21-faq-title{cursor:pointer;position:relative;padding-right:25px}.js .promo21-faq-title:after{position:absolute;top:0;right:0;height:1.2em;width:16px;font-family:"entypo";content:'';text-align:right;-webkit-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.js .promo21-faq-content{overflow:hidden;height:auto;max-height:0;padding-top:0;-webkit-transition:all .2s ease-in-out;-o-transition:all .2s ease-in-out;transition:all .2s ease-in-out}.js .promo21-faq.open .promo21-faq-content{max-height:250px;padding-top:25px}.js .promo21-faq.open .promo21-faq-title:after{-web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}